ABOUT BY KILIAN GOOD GIRL GONE BAD

This fragrance immediately announces itself with a bright, intriguing start. A vivid burst of osmanthus lends a fruity, apricot-like sweetness, beautifully intertwined with the lush, intoxicating scent of jasmine. This initial impression is further softened and refined by the classic, elegant touch of May rose, creating a sophisticated floral bouquet that feels both fresh and subtly opulent from the very first breath. It's a predominantly white floral and fruity opening, suggesting a playful yet confident spirit. As the scent settles, its heart reveals a deeper, more voluptuous character. Indian tuberose emerges as the star, unfolding with its signature creamy, rich, and sometimes daring white floral intensity. This potent floralcy is perfectly balanced by the green, slightly honeyed nuances of narcissus, which introduces a captivating yellow floral facet. The evolution here moves from a bright, inviting introduction to a more assertive and magnetic presence, hinting at a woman who embraces her complexities. This makes it particularly suited for moments when a distinct impression is desired, perhaps a special evening or a confident daytime statement. The journey concludes with a warm and grounding dry down. The rich, golden warmth of amber provides a comforting embrace, adding a smooth, resinous depth that lingers beautifully. This is subtly anchored by the clean, elegant woodiness of cedar, ensuring a sophisticated and enduring finish. The overall impression is one of a captivating, full-bodied floral that transitions gracefully from sparkling to deeply resonant. It’s a versatile floral for cooler evenings or making an impactful statement in any season, leaning towards autumn and winter with its underlying warmth, but its vibrant heart can carry it through spring and summer nights.
